    Abstract: The disclosure belongs to the technical field of medicine. Provided are a CD97 and GSDME interaction inhibitor having anti-tumor activity and an application thereof. A compound screened in the disclosure enhances the susceptibility of NK cells to kill tumor cells by inhibiting the interaction between GSDME and CD97 in tumor cells, so as to induce an immune anti-tumor effect. Moreover, the compound enhances the susceptibility of tumor cells to pyroptosis by blocking the protective effect of CD97 on cleavage of GSDME proteins. Therefore, the compound can be used for treating GSDME and CD97 double-positive malignant tumors, and combined chemotherapy, immunotherapy, etc., to enhance the susceptibility of malignant tumors to chemotherapy and immunotherapy, prolonging the overall survival period of patients with malignant tumors. Specifically provided is a compound having a structure set forth in formula (I), a pharmaceutically acceptable salt, a solvent compound or a deuterated compound thereof.

    Abstract: A fault detection method, apparatus, and system, and a vehicle, which relates to the field of vehicle control technology. The method includes: acquiring a first signal output by the valve core detection sensor and a second signal output by the draw-wire encoder on each of the plurality of support legs; and determining whether the draw-wire encoder provided on each support leg has a fault according to the first signal, and the second signal output by the draw-wire encoder of each support leg. For the fault detection method, apparatus and system, and the vehicle, it can be used for the solution of detecting whether the draw-wire encoder on the work machine is damaged in real-time, so as to improve the reliability and security of the device.

    Abstract: The present disclosure provides modified cell(s), i.e., immune cell(s) or precursor cell(s) thereof, wherein the cell(s) are engineered to express: (a) a first chimeric antigen receptor (CAR) having affinity for CD19, and (b) a second CAR having affinity for a tumor antigen, wherein the tumor antigen is not CD19. Also provided are methods and uses of the modified cells, e.g., for treating at least one sign and/or symptom of cancer in a subject. The modified cells expand in the peripheral blood of the subject. Related nucleic acids, vectors, and pharmaceutical compositions are also provided.

    Abstract: A machine tool rapid compensation system includes: a trigger acquisition module, a laser interferometry measurement module, a data analysis and compensation module, and a communication module. The trigger acquisition module receives a trigger acquisition instruction, converts an encoder position value into a pulse value, transmits the pulse value to the laser interferometry measurement module, retrieves parameter information and compensation point information of a machine tool from a numerical control system, and generates a machine tool operation code and a measurement preparation signal. The laser interferometry measurement module receives the measurement preparation signal and the pulse value to obtain error data, environmental data, and expansion compensation values.

    Abstract: This specification relates to an apparatus which stores a machine-learned model including a first neural network block including multiple convolutional neural network layers, a second neural network block including at least one dilated convolutional neural network layer, and a linear transformation block. The apparatus is configured to receive input data representing in-phase and quadrature signals of an input signal that is to be amplified by a power amplifier, to process the received input data using the first neural network block of the machine learned model to generate a first neural network block output, to process the received input data using the second neural network block of the machine learned model to generate a second neural network block output, and to combine, using the linear transformation block, the first neural network block output and the second neural network block output to generate a pre-distorted signal for amplification by the power amplifier.

    Abstract: A computer implemented method for recognizing an answer sheet includes the steps of: reading a filled answer sheet comprising at least one set of graphical codes; locating each set of graphical codes in the answer sheet; a set of graphical codes comprising one grid or two grids, wherein for each set of graphical codes, if the function mark of the first grid is filled, two sets or four sets of 8-digit binary codes are obtained according to the filling state of each of the filling areas in each grid of the set of graphical codes; and recognizing the corresponding characters according to the encoding format determined by the encoding format mark. If the function mark in the first grid is un-filled, the filling states of the eight icons of the encoding format mark are converted to the third set of binary codes for character recognition.

    Abstract: A method for preparing an accelerator for sprayed mortar/concrete is provided. The accelerator includes an organic component, inorganic component aluminum sulfate, an initiator, and a reductant. The organic component in the form of a polymer monomer is added to concrete and polymerized into a polymer network structure in the presence of the initiator and the reductant; and the inorganic component aluminum sulfate promotes rapid hydration of the concrete to form an inorganic network structure. Such organic-inorganic interpenetrating network thickens a cement-based material rapidly to achieve strong adhesion, fast-setting and hardening properties and effectively reduces resilience of the sprayed mortar/concrete. The accelerator prepared by the method is well compatible with all sorts of cement, efficient and environmentally friendly.

    Abstract: A method for preparing comb structure temperature/pH-responsive polycarboxylic acid by end-group functionalization adopts temperature/pH-responsive monomer, unsaturated halogenated hydrocarbon, small monomer of carboxylic acid and other raw materials to prepare polycarboxylic acid material via self-polymerization, substitution and copolymerization. Temperature/pH-responsive monomers are first self-polymerized to obtain temperature/pH-responsive polymer chain with end-group functionalization, and then substitution with unsaturated halogenated hydrocarbons is conducted to obtain temperature/pH-responsive macromonomers with end-group functionalization, finally the obtained product is copolymerized with small carboxylic acid monomers to prepare comb structure polymer with polycarboxylic acid main chain and temperature/pH-responsive side chain.

    Abstract: A preparation method of comb structure temperature/pH-responsive polycarboxylic acid adopts acrylic ester, temperature/pH-responsive monomer and other raw materials to obtain polycarboxylic acid via acrylate monomer self-polymerization, grafting with temperature/pH-responsive monomers and hydrolyzation. In other words, acrylate is used as the reaction monomer to polymerize polyacrylate with controllable molecular weight under the action of initiator and chain transfer agent, then the graft copolymers are copolymerized with temperature/pH-responsive monomers to obtain graft copolymers with acrylate polymers main chain and temperature/pH-responsive polymer side chains. Finally, the graft copolymer is hydrolyzed to obtain the comb structure temperature/pH-responsive polycarboxylic acid with polyacrylic acid main chain and temperature/pH-responsive monomer side chain.

    Abstract: A star-shaped polyacrylamide copolymer and a preparation method thereof are provided, as well as a drilling fluid containing the star-shaped polyacrylamide copolymer. Only the star-shaped polyacrylamide copolymer is added into the drilling fluid; under a high-temperature environment, the filtration volume of the drilling fluid can be reduced, the high-temperature rheological property of the drilling fluid is improved, and the pressure loss of a circulation system of the drilling fluid is reduced.
